MOORPARK : Youth Arrested in Stabbing of Man

Detectives arrested a Thousand Oaks teen-ager on Friday afternoon in connection with the stabbing earlier this week of a 23-year-old Moorpark man.
The 17-year-old male, who was not identified because he is a minor, was arrested for the attempted murder of Jaime Sanchez Hernandez, Sheriff’s Lt. Dante Honorico said.
Hernandez suffered multiple stab wounds to his head and abdomen during what detectives described as a gang-related dispute Sunday night near Hillcrest Drive and Avenida de la Plata in Thousand Oaks. He remains in serious but stable condition at Los Robles Regional Medical Center in Thousand Oaks, officials said.
Honorico said more arrests are expected in the incident. Investigators have identified three other juveniles as possible suspects, but are still looking for them, detectives said.
The arrested youth was transferred to juvenile hall, officials said.
